WASHINGTON — True to form, former “Apprentice” star Omarosa is ending her time at the White House with a dose of drama.
Omarosa Manigault Newman, one of President Donald Trump’s most prominent African-American supporters, was escorted off the White House grounds after resigning her post as a presidential adviser, according to two White House officials.
White House press secretary Sarah Huckabee Sanders said Wednesday that Manigault Newman’s resignation is effective Jan. 20, one year after Trump’s inauguration.
